Photo credit: James Ragan Photography With the Spring game just two days away, Sportslowdown.com sat down with Florida Tech Panthers head football coach Steve Englehart, to get his early thoughts on the Panthers 2017 season. With an 8-3 record, including five wins in the Gulf South Conference, the Panthers are coming off their first ever playoff appearance in 2016, the Panthers are primed to make another run through the Gulf South Conference and get back to the postseason in 2017. “Expectations are high as always, you wanna get out there and compete each and every week,” said Englehart. “Hopefully at the end of the season you’re sitting there with a chance to win the conference and go to the playoffs. It is time for the Jacksonville Jaguars to walk the walk. It is the third year for quarterback Blake Bortles and head coach Gus Bradley is in his fourth. It was made clear by team owner Shad Khan before the end of last season, that things were going to have to turn around in 2016. Khan has been a man of his word since getting to Jacksonville, whether it was his plans for the team or upgrades to EverBank Stadium, he has followed through. There is no reason to think he won’t follow through on changing things up if this team struggles this season. Bradley was known as a defensive specialist when he took the job in Jacksonville, mainly because of the Seahawks defense he built in 2013 that allowed 15.3 points per game. Yes, that team had different personnel and at a lot of positions, better personnel, no one would argue that.
